引言
随着互联网技术的飞速发展,网络安全问题日益凸显。网络攻击手段层出不穷,给个人、企业和国家带来了巨大的安全隐患。本文将深入解析网络攻击的类型、防范策略以及应对措施,帮助读者了解并应对现代网络安全威胁。
一、网络攻击的类型
1. 网络钓鱼
网络钓鱼是攻击者通过伪装成合法机构发送邮件或短信,诱骗用户泄露个人信息的一种攻击手段。防范网络钓鱼,用户应提高警惕,不随意点击不明链接,不轻易透露个人信息。
2. 恶意软件
恶意软件包括病毒、木马、蠕虫等,能够破坏计算机系统、窃取用户数据或控制用户设备。防范恶意软件,用户应安装正规防病毒软件,定期更新系统,不下载不明来源的软件。
3. 拒绝服务攻击(DDoS)
拒绝服务攻击通过大量请求占用目标服务器资源,使正常用户无法访问。防范DDoS攻击,企业可采取流量清洗、防火墙等措施,提高网络抗攻击能力。
4. SQL注入
SQL注入攻击利用网页输入框的漏洞,插入恶意SQL代码,获取数据库敏感信息。防范SQL注入,开发者应加强输入验证,使用预处理语句等安全编码实践。
5. 中间人攻击(MITM)
中间人攻击攻击者拦截用户与服务器之间的通信,窃取或篡改信息。防范中间人攻击,用户应使用HTTPS等加密协议,确保数据传输安全。
二、防范网络攻击的策略
1. 加强安全意识
提高网络安全意识是防范网络攻击的基础。用户应定期接受安全培训,了解各种网络攻击手段,提高警惕性。
2. 采用安全防护技术
企业应采用防火墙、入侵检测系统、安全审计等安全防护技术,提高网络抗攻击能力。
3. 安全编码实践
开发者应遵循安全编码规范,避免漏洞的产生。例如,使用预处理语句、输入验证等安全实践。
4. 定期更新系统与软件
定期更新操作系统、应用程序和插件,修复已知漏洞,降低攻击风险。
5. 数据加密
对敏感数据进行加密,防止数据泄露。
三、应对网络攻击的措施
1. 事故响应
建立事故响应机制,一旦发生网络攻击,迅速采取措施遏制攻击,减少损失。
2. 法律途径
通过法律途径追究攻击者的责任,维护自身权益。
3. 修复漏洞
针对攻击者利用的漏洞进行修复,防止再次遭受攻击。
4. 恢复数据
在攻击发生后,尽快恢复受损数据,降低损失。
总结
网络攻击是现代网络安全面临的严峻挑战。通过了解网络攻击类型、防范策略和应对措施,我们能够更好地应对网络安全威胁,保障个人信息和财产安全。让我们共同努力,构建一个安全、稳定的网络环境。
